Aw man. Being in nursing school I could talk about poop forever, but I see DatMurse got to it first! :laugh:
What have you tried to fix it? Has this happened before? What did you do then that fixed it? Have there been any changes in daily routine (are you now busy with some activity at the time you would normally go)? Stress? TOM?
I'd definitely call your doctor - but these are questions she/he will probably ask you anyway, so they'd be good to think about.0 -

I have IBS and often times have issues with this. There is a detox tea that helps me a lot. It's by Jillian Michaels.
2 tablespoons fresh lemon juice
1 tablespoon natural non-sweetened cranberry juice (do not buy cranberry juice cocktail)
1 teabag of dandelion root tea
64 ouces of water
Just make the tea according to the box and add the juices in. Drink the entire batch throughout the day for 5 days. It helps so much with me.0 -
Generally, I will have 3 - 4 bowl movements per week, which is normal for me. However, I haven't had a bowl movement for about 7 or 8 days now. I haven't changed anything in my diet. I don't feel constipated or any discomfort at all. Is this something I should be worried about?
